Yamin, a Season 5 “Idol” finalist, has been busy touring behind his successful debut. And now the singer is stepping up to support a cause that’s particularly important to him — diabetes awareness.
The pop singer, who has type 1 diabetes, is serving as a Global Ambassador to promote the Diabetes Creative Expression Competition, an international contest looking for submissions from those with diabetes, as well as their family and friends, to express what diabetes means to them.
In addition to promoting the contest, Yamin will help judge U.S. entries. The singer even has agreed to donate a prize of concert tickets and backstage passes to those winners.
“I’m thrilled to be joining this important campaign to help children with diabetes around the world,” Yamin, 29, said in a press release. The singer was diagnosed with type 1 diabetes at age 16. “Children in developing nations often lack the medicines, supplies, education and basic care they need to survive and thrive. Even here in the U.S., there are kids who want to attend a diabetes camp but can’t afford it. By participating in the Inspired by Diabetes contest and expressing how diabetes affects you, you can have a direct impact on a child’s life.”
Submissions, which are encouraged through art, essays, poetry, photography and music, are being accepted until Jan. 31. Entries are being accepted in these categories:
— Short essay or poem – 500 words or less
— Photograph(s) – Up to three prints
— Original drawing or painting – no larger than 43cm x 66cm (17” x 26”)
— Music – Original composition, up to three minutes in length (instrumental and lyric)
The Inspired By Diabetes contest categories are:
— Children (age sub-groups 5-6, 7-8, 9-12, 13-17 years old; includes children with diabetes or family members or friends under 18
— Adult with diabetes (ages 18 and older)
— Family member or friend of a person with diabetes
— Health care professional
